Blink, and you might well miss something a little unusual about the quaint, almost village-like, centre of Old Harlow in Essex. Here, amongst a scattering of businesses, a church and a community centre, sits a campus belonging not to a British university but a Canadian one headquartered 2,327 miles (3,745 km) away. How and why did it end up here?

Exit mobile version